Long haul is always very thin on the ground during the winter months. Only this year have we seen an increase, primarily due to cruise charters to LRM, BGI, SDQ and MIA. I often think a long haul charter destination would prove popular during the winter months, but obviously the demand is not there or charter operators would operate one. Remember NCL's long haul capacity has droppped for the coming summer. 1 flight less to CUN, 2 lost to Dom Rep.
